Default [INFO][KERNEL][GB] Lynx Kernel by byeonggonlee |Voodoo|Ezekeel's MOD

This kernel has been released and updated in Korean local community.

Crackflashers, give it a try

If byeonggon personally open the thread, this one will be closed.

byeonggon's twitter

byeonggon's blog

Features:
  • Based on stock kernel
  • Kernel patched from 2.6.35.7 to 2.6.35.14
  • Added BLD, BLN, BLX, CustomVoltage, LiveOC, Touchwake
    (thanks to Ezekeel, neldar)
  • Modified LiveOC
  • Added Voodoo Color and Voodoo Sound
    (thanks to supercurio)
  • Added Governors
    (interactiveX, lagfree, lazy, Smartass v2 and Intellidemand, Interactive, Lulzactive v2, Scary, Smartass) from AIR-Kernel, cm-kernel, SG-NS-ICS, GLaDOS. Thanks to Ezekeel, KalimochoAz, r_data, Steve Garon.
  • Added I/O Schedulers
    (BFQ-v2-r1, SIO, VR)
  • Tweaked Governors - Consulted franciscofranco's tweak(thanks to franciscofranco)
    (Conservative, Ondemand)
  • Kernel Samepage Merging(thanks to morfic)
  • CPUIdle backport from 3.2 Kernel - Consulted SG-NS-ICS(thanks to Steve Garon)
    or
    Deepidle (Cherry-picked GLaDOS. Thanks to Ezekeel)
  • Normal-Overclocked with LiveOC or Bus-Overclocked without LiveOC
  • Change battery percentage calculation.(thanks to KalimochoAz)
  • Increased frame rate to 65fps
  • SLQB Memory allocator.
  • BIGMEM support.
  • Optimized CRC32 algorithm
  • Optimized ARM RWSEM algorithm
  • and more tweaks...



Source Code:

https://github.com/byeonggon/lynx-nexus-s
